About

Jinwook Lee is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Animal Science and Zoology and Food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Jinwook Lee has authored 50 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Molecular Biology, 13 papers in Animal Science and Zoology and 11 papers in Food Science. Recurrent topics in Jinwook Lee's work include Animal Nutrition and Physiology (10 papers), Genetic and phenotypic traits in livestock (8 papers) and Food Quality and Safety Studies (8 papers). Jinwook Lee is often cited by papers focused on Animal Nutrition and Physiology (10 papers), Genetic and phenotypic traits in livestock (8 papers) and Food Quality and Safety Studies (8 papers). Jinwook Lee coll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, China and Malaysia. Jinwook Lee's co-authors include In S. Kim, Mi‐Jin Choi, Kyoung‐Yeol Kim, Kyu‐Jung Chae, Jae‐Hong Kim, Geun-Young Kim, Chu‐Myong Seong, Ji Min Seo, Sung-Hoon Cho and Un‐Kyung Kim and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, The Journal of Immunology and PLoS ONE.
